DESCRIPTION:Bellingham SeaFeast is a FREE two-day celebration on the shores of Squalicum Harbor dedicated to honoring our rich maritime culture\, showcasing our thriving working waterfront\, promoting the enjoyment and conservation of our precious water resources\, celebrating the vitality of our commercial fishing and seafood industries\, and indulging in the diverse culinary bounty that characterizes our corner of the Pacific Northwest. \nLearn more here. \n

SUMMARY:Issaquah Salmon Days
DESCRIPTION:Celebrate the annual return of the salmon at the 55th annual Issaquah Salmon Days! \nJoin us at Salmon Days on October 5th and 6th 2024! There will be lots and lots of ARTS\, CRAFTS\,\nFOOD\, BBQ\, FISHES\, BEER\, WINE\, LOCAL ENTERTAINMENT\, & ACTIVITIES FOR THE KIDDOS.\nFor more information about the LARGEST 2-Day festival in the state visit: www.salmondays.org \nHere are some fun facts about the Salmon Days Festival and the fish we adore: \n\nIn 1970\, the Issaquah Chamber of Commerce presented the first Salmon Days festival.\nThe event grew out of the desire to replace the once-popular Labor Day celebration\,as well as\na need to celebrate one of Issaquah’s greatest treasures – the annual return of the salmon.\nIn the beginning\, the festival attractions included the Kiwanis Salmon BBQ\, salmon hatchery\ndisplays\, an art show\, children’s parade led by the late J.P. Patches\, Little League football\ngames at Veterans Memorial Field\, fire crew competitions\, and more.\nIn 1980 the Salmon Days festival and Grande Parade underwent two major changes that\nhave been credited with altering the course of the festival: Salmon Days became a\nSeafair-sanctioned event and a festival float was created again.\nTo aid the growth process\, merchandise was introduced\, the first paid festival director\nwas hired and large ohfishal spawnsors came on board in the ’80s\n​Today\, Salmon Days is still presented by the Greater Issaquah Chamber of Commerce\nwith the goal of providing a community celebration focused on honoring the\nmiraculous return of the salmon.\n\nLearn more here. \n
